If Grande Prairie Gymnastics cancels your class due to enrollment or scheduling issues, you will receive a full refund with no additional administrative fees.
After your first class, GP Gymnastics maintains a No Refund Policy on all our fees to ensure proper safety and staffing for our classes and events apart from medical or moving as outlined below.
In the unfortunate circumstance where a participant must withdraw from the program due to medical reasons, refund requests must be made in writing and accompanied with a medical note signed by a health practitioner. Medical refunds will be provided on a pro-rated basis effective the day the letter and notice are submitted.
If a participant must withdraw due to moving further than 100kms from the GP Gymnastics Center, refund requests must be made in writing with proof of new address within seven (7) days of withdrawal from the program. The refund will be pro-rated and is effective the day written notice is provided.
Please be advised: Insurance fees are non-refundable under all circumstances.
If the enrolled program runs for 8 or more months, this is considered a Full Year Program.
If you wish to withdraw your child from their program, you MUST give your program coordinator a 30-day notice on the 1st day of the month. Your monthly installments will cease the month following your notice. You may receive a refund for your initial payment of your last month. If you paid the program fee in full, you would receive a refund for the remainder of the year.
Failure to give a 30-day notice will result in your initial last month payment fee not being refunded.
